RIDOT Says 6-10 Connector Change Happening Tomorrow

(Providence, RI)  --  The Rhode Island Department of Transportation is letting drivers know that an anticipated traffic pattern change for the Route 6-10 interchange project is happening a couple of days earlier than originally scheduled.  RIDOT says a new pattern will be implemented tomorrow due to adverse weather forecasted for later this week.  The 6-10 split will be moved about a half-mile to the north of its current location, meaning drivers using the 6-10 connector outbound will encounter the change more quickly.  The change is being implemented so that demolition of old road and bridge sections can continue through the winter months, according to RIDOT.
